Jex - supported Latex

by David K. Levine

Jex expects latex fragments enclosed in brackets {} and treats $'s as \$'s

Macros that do not exist in standard Latex; Jex will always try to convert these to equivalent Latex macros before writing, so these should not ordinarily occur in Jex output

\leftgroup{}  \rightgroup{} - groups of fence delimiters, for example \leftgroup{[} is equivalent to \left[

\overset{}{} - groups of embellishments set above, for example \overset{-}{a} is equivalent to \overline a

\underset{}{} - groups of embellishments set below, for example \underset{-}{a} is equivalent to \underline a

{} \overgroup{}{} - groups of horizontal division style delimiters, for example {a} \overgroup{-} {b} is equivalent to a \over b

\unicode{c-style-hex-string} - the unicode character refered to by hex-string

Treatment of functions

functions such as \log \sin and so forth are converted by Jex to \mathrm{log} \mathrm{sin}

Latex constructs supported in Jex

No non-mathematical constructs are supported, and support for some symbols is not yet implemented. When macros unknown to it are encountered, Jex will try to ignore them.
Supported
        \begin{align} \end{align}
        \begin{array} \end{array}
        &
        \\ recognized as an array delimiter, but comments are not supported
        \mathrm{}
        \, \: \; negative spaces are neither recognized nor implemented
        \left[{( \right]})
        \root[]{} recognized by the parser but not currently implemented in Jex
        \over
        superscripts and subscripts
        upper and lower case greek alphabet
        named functions
        embellishments both narrow and wide and underline
        all the symbols I know about except those listed below
Not Supported
        under and overbraces
        \frac
        \begin{math} \begin{display} \begin{equation} and the corresponding \end and the abbreviations \( \[
            these are essentially meaningless in Jex but the parser needs to do a better job of ignoring them
